I have been running this combo as my primary editing workstation for about 60 days now. The 20-core i7-14700K chews through Premiere Pro timelines like nothing I have used before. A 12-minute 4K H.265 export that took 8 minutes on my older 12-core system now finishes in just under 4 minutes. The 8 performance cores handle playback scrubbing while the 12 efficiency cores crush export queues in parallel.

The ASUS TUF Z790-Plus WiFi motherboard is the unsung hero here. Its 16+1 DrMOS power stages stay cool even during hour-long export sessions in my testing. I monitored VRM temperatures with HWiNFO and never saw them climb above 68°C under full load, which is impressive for sustained workloads. The PCIe 5.0 support means you are ready for next-generation GPUs and NVMe drives without an upgrade.

INLAND by Micro Center CPU Motherboard Intel i7-14700K 14th Gen 20-Cores LGA 1700 Desktop Processor with ASUS TUF Gaming Z790-Plus WiFi DDR5 Motherboard customer photo 1

The dual DDR5 and DDR4 memory support is something I wish more boards offered. If you are upgrading from an older 12th-gen build, you can keep your existing DDR4 RAM and migrate to DDR5 later. The 4 DIMM slots support up to 192GB, which is more than enough for 8K editing workflows.

In real-world DaVinci Resolve testing, this combo handled 6K BRAW timelines with light noise reduction without dropping frames. Color grading was snappy, and the Fusion page responded with no lag. For Adobe Premiere Pro users, the multi-threaded export speed is where this combo truly shines.

The 9800X3D is a special chip for video editing because of its 104MB total cache (L2 + L3 stacked). In After Effects and DaVinci Resolve, where complex effect graphs constantly read and write to cache, the 3D V-Cache delivers noticeable gains. I measured 18% faster render times on After Effects compositions compared to a standard 9700X.

The MSI MAG X870E Tomahawk motherboard is a premium pairing. With 14+2+1 Duet Rail Power Stages and DDR5 8400+ OC support, this board pushes the 9800X3D to its full potential. Wi-Fi 7 connectivity is a nice future-proof touch, and the dual PCIe 5.0 M.2 slots let you run a fast scratch disk plus project storage without compromise.

Buying Guide: How to Choose the Best CPU Motherboard Combo for Video Editing

Choosing the right CPU motherboard combo for video editing comes down to matching your workload to the right core count, chipset, and VRM quality. Let me break down the key factors I evaluated when testing each combo on this list.

Core Count and Threads

For video editing, cores matter more than most other tasks. Premiere Pro and DaVinci Resolve both scale well with multi-core CPUs, especially during export. I recommend at least 8 cores for 4K editing, 12 cores for 6K, and 16+ cores for 8K workflows. The 20-core combos on this list handle everything I threw at them.

If you primarily scrub timelines and apply effects (single-threaded tasks), single-core clock speed is more important. This is where the i9-14900K with its 6.0 GHz boost shines, and why the 9800X3D with its massive cache is so good for After Effects.

VRM Quality and Power Delivery

The motherboard’s VRMs (Voltage Regulator Modules) determine how cleanly and stably your CPU receives power. Weak VRMs cause thermal throttling under sustained loads, which directly impacts long export jobs. Look for boards with at least 12+1 power stages for mid-range CPUs, and 16+1 or higher for flagship chips.

The ASUS TUF and MSI PRO boards on this list all have robust VRM designs that I verified with HWiNFO monitoring during hour-long export sessions. For sustained video editing workloads, do not skimp on VRM quality.

RAM Support and Capacity

Video editing is RAM-hungry. I recommend at least 32GB for 4K work and 64GB for 6K or higher. All DDR5 combos on this list support at least 192GB, which gives you plenty of headroom. The DDR4 combo (Ryzen 5 5500) is limited to 128GB, which is still enough for most workflows.

For Adobe Premiere Pro, faster RAM (DDR5 6000+) reduces timeline scrubbing lag. For DaVinci Resolve, RAM capacity matters more than speed. Match your RAM choice to your primary software.

Chipset Features and Connectivity

The chipset determines PCIe lanes, USB ports, and connectivity features. For video editing, I look for PCIe 5.0 support (for next-gen GPUs and NVMe), USB 3.2 Gen 2×2 (for fast external storage), and Thunderbolt 4 headers (for high-speed scratch drives). The Z890, X870E, and Z790 boards on this list check all these boxes.

Software-Specific Tips

For Adobe Premiere Pro, prioritize multi-core CPUs and fast RAM. The 20-core combos deliver the fastest export times. For DaVinci Resolve, GPU matters more than CPU, but you still want at least 8 cores for timeline playback. For After Effects, the 3D V-Cache on the 9800X3D is a game-changer for complex compositions.
